				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Ingredients: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_1  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ul>
<li>2 lbs Ground turkey (can use ground chicken instead)</li>
<li>4 tbsp Garlic ghee (halved) set aside 2 tablespoons for cooking</li>
<li>1 cup Chopped onion</li>
<li>¼ cup Cashew powder</li>
<li>2 Eggs, beaten</li>
<li>2 tbsp Bombay Curry Spice Rub</li>
<li>2 tbsp Salt</li>
<li>Buns, red and green chutney, and any other burger toppings of your choice.</li>
</ul></div>
			</div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_column et_pb_column_3_5 et_pb_column_2  et_pb_css_mix_blend_mode_passthrough et-last-child">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_module et_pb_heading et_pb_heading_1 et_pb_bg_layout_">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Steps: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_2  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ol>
<li>In a large mixing bowl add all ingredients and mix together well. Knead the mixture to ensure everything is evenly distributed into the meat. Refrigerate for 10-15 minutes.</li>
<li>Once chilled, make 8 ounce burger patties and brush them with some reserved garlic ghee. Place the patties on medium heat in a skillet and cook 3-4 minutes each side.</li>
<li>If you choose to grill these, use medium heat and grill 3-4 minutes each side.</li>
<li>Use the rest of your garlic ghee and spread onto your bun tops. Sprinkle a little Bombay Curry Spice and roast them in your skillet or on your grill for 1-2 minutes.</li>
<li>You can spread your favorite chutney (sweet or hot) on your bun, add your patty and enjoy!</li>

				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Ingredients: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_4  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ul>
<li>2-3 Small Diced potatoes</li>
<li>½ cup Chopped Kale</li>
<li>½ cup Diced Peppers</li>
<li>¼ cup Diced Red or Yellow Onion</li>
<li>1 tsp Chopped Garlic</li>
<li>1 tbsp Ghee</li>
<li>1 tbsp Chopped Cilantro</li>
<li>1 tbsp Bombay Curry Spice Rub</li>
<li>Pinch Salt or to taste</li>
<li>2 Eggs</li>
</ul></div>
			</div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_column et_pb_column_3_5 et_pb_column_5  et_pb_css_mix_blend_mode_passthrough et-last-child">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_module et_pb_heading et_pb_heading_3 et_pb_bg_layout_">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Steps: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_5  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ol>
<li>Add ghee, onion, and garlic to a pan on low heat. Bring it to a sizzle and toss the onion and garlic around in the ghee for 2-3 mins.</li>
<li>Add Bombay Curry Spice Rub and saute for a min</li>
<li>Add in kale and peppers and roast the mixture for 2 more mins. Add potatoes, cilantro, and salt and pepper. Mix around and cover to let it cook for about 10 minutes. Be sure to stir the mixture every 2-3 minutes to prevent burning.</li>
<li>In a separate pan, add some ghee and cook the 2 eggs to your preference. Add eggs on top of the hash mix.</li>
<li>Enjoy with some avocado, or simply put it on some toast!</li>
<li>Yields 2-3 Servings</li>

				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p><strong>Ghee: Liquid Gold for Thanksgiving Magic</strong></p>
<p>Begin your culinary journey by replacing traditional cooking oils with the golden richness of ghee. Renowned for its nutty aroma and distinct flavor, ghee adds a luxurious touch to your Thanksgiving dishes. Use it to baste your turkey, roast vegetables, or sauté stuffing ingredients. The high smoke point of ghee ensures a crisp, golden finish on your dishes, imparting a unique depth of flavor that will have your guests asking for seconds.</p>
<p><strong>Bombay Curry Spice Rub: A Symphony of Aromas</strong></p>
<p>Introduce a burst of Indian flavors to your Thanksgiving turkey by incorporating Bombay Curry Spice Rub into your marinade or rub. This aromatic blend typically includes coriander, cumin, turmeric, fenugreek, and other spices that lend a harmonious balance of earthiness, warmth, and a touch of heat. Rub the spice blend under the turkey skin, allowing the aromatic notes to permeate the meat during the roasting process. The result? A succulent, flavorful bird that will leave your guests raving about your culinary prowess.</p>
<p><strong>Garam Masala Spice Mix: Warming Up Your Sides</strong></p>
<p>Transform your traditional Thanksgiving sides into a sensory experience by infusing the warm and robust notes of Garam Masala Spice Blend. This spice blend, composed of cinnamon, cardamom, cloves, cumin, and coriander, and other spices imparts a rich, complex flavor profile to dishes like mashed potatoes, sweet potato casserole, or even butternut squash soup. Add a pinch to your gravy for an unexpected twist that will keep your guests guessing and savoring each bite.</p>
<p><strong>Kashmiri Chili Powder: Adding a Fiery Elegance</strong></p>
<p>For those seeking a touch of heat without overwhelming the palate, Kashmiri chili powder is the perfect choice. Known for its vibrant red hue and moderate spiciness, this chili powder can be incorporated into cranberry sauces, glazes, or even rubbed onto your turkey for a visually stunning and deliciously nuanced result. Elevate your Thanksgiving menu by introducing this elegant spice that adds a subtle kick, allowing the other flavors to shine.</p>
<p><strong>Cardamom: Sweetly Sublime Endings</strong></p>
<p>Finish your Thanksgiving feast on a sweet note by infusing desserts with the fragrant allure of cardamom. Whether it&#8217;s added to pumpkin pie, apple crisp, or even whipped cream, cardamom brings a subtle sweetness and a hint of citrus that complements traditional Thanksgiving desserts. Elevate your homemade pies or desserts with a dash of this versatile spice, and watch as your guests savor the unexpected layers of flavor.</p>

				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Ingredients: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_9  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ul>
<li>2 lbs Lamb or mutton meat with bones, cut into medium pieces</li>
<li>1 c Water</li>
<li>1 c Yogurt (Full Fat)</li>
<li>½ c Vegetable oil or Mustard oil</li>
<li>2 Black Cardamom Pods</li>
<li>4 Green Cardamom Pods</li>
<li>4 Whole Cloves</li>
<li>1 in Cinnamon Stick</li>
<li>1 Bay Leaf</li>
<li>1/2 tsp Black Pepper &#8211; ground</li>
<li>1/2 tsp Asafoetida</li>
<li>2 tsp Kashmiri Red Chili Powder</li>
<li>1/2 tsp Bombay Curry Spice Blend</li>
<li>1c Cilantro leaves torn off stem (use for garnish)</li>
</ul></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_heading et_pb_heading_5 et_pb_bg_layout_">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Ingredients For Marinade [Make First]: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_10  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ul>
<li>1 tbsp Ginger Garlic Paste</li>
<li>1 tbsp Chili Peppers crushed</li>
<li>1 tsp Bombay Curry Spice Blend</li>
<li>1 tsp Kashmiri Red Chili Powder</li>
</ul></div>
			</div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_column et_pb_column_3_5 et_pb_column_10  et_pb_css_mix_blend_mode_passthrough et-last-child">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_module et_pb_heading et_pb_heading_6 et_pb_bg_layout_">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_heading_container"><h3 class="et_pb_module_heading">Steps:</h3></div>
			</div><div class="et_pb_module et_pb_text et_pb_text_11  et_pb_text_align_left et_pb_bg_layout_light">
				
				
				
				
				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><ol>
<li>Wash lamb or mutton and drain the water completely. Once the marinade is made, cover this bowl with plastic wrap and marinate for 1 ½ hours.</li>
<li>Next in a heavy bottom pan (make sure it has a lid) add your vegetable oil (or mustard oil), bay leaf, black and green Cardamom pods, whole Cloves, Cinnamon stick and fry this on medium or high heat for 1-2 minutes then immediately add your marinated lamb or mutton and keep frying while occasionally stirring.</li>
<li>Next add the Asafoetida and stir well. Then add your 1 cup of water and stir, put a lid on the pot and let it cook. In a separate bowl add yogurt, Kashmiri chili powder, and ½ teaspoon of Bombay Curry Spice Blend and whisk together until well blended.</li>
<li>Next take the lid off and add the yogurt mixture and stir well. Add salt to taste and cook this until the lamb or mutton is soft and tender. Serve over rice or Rotis and garnish with Cilantro.</li>
<li>Yields 6 Servings</li>
